Satisfactory is very RAM hungry. For the start (Tier 1-4), 10 GB RAM is often enough. But as soon as you build larger factories (Tier 5+), we strongly recommend 12 GB or 16 GB RAM to avoid lags and crashes. For Mega-Bases, even more is often necessary.

Yes, absolutely! You can simply upload your `.sav` file via SFTP or via the web interface to the folder `.config/Epic/FactoryGame/Saved/SaveGames/server`. Then select the savegame in the server settings.

Yes, you can switch between the stable Early Access version and the Experimental version in our panel at any time. Note, however, that Experimental versions can be more unstable.

Officially, Satisfactory supports 4 players in multiplayer. You can increase this limit in the config (`Game.ini`), but the game is not optimized for very many players, which can lead to performance problems. We recommend 4-8 players.

By default, the server pauses the game when no player is online to save resources. However, you can change this in the server settings so that the factory continues to run even without players (Attention: This continues to consume CPU/RAM).

When connecting to the server for the first time, you will be asked to set an admin password. After that, you can authenticate yourself as admin in the game via the 'Server Manager' menu with this password and change settings.

Yes, Satisfactory supports Crossplay between Steam and Epic Games. Since our servers are Dedicated Servers, players from both platforms can connect without problems.

The server performs regular autosaves (default is every 5 minutes). You can adjust this interval in the server settings. Longer intervals can reduce the short 'lag spikes' when saving large saves.

Lags in the late-game are often due to the CPU limitation of the game itself or too little RAM. Check the RAM usage in the panel. If it is at the limit, an upgrade helps. Reducing unnecessary conveyor belts or enclosing factories can also help.

Satisfactory Dedicated Servers support mods (via the Satisfactory Mod Manager / ficsit.app), but support is still experimental and can be complicated. We offer SFTP access so you can install mods manually, but do not provide direct support for mod problems.

The savegames are located in the directory `.config/Epic/FactoryGame/Saved/SaveGames/server`. You can download them via SFTP at any time to back them up locally or play in singleplayer.

Yes, you can adjust the network settings in the `Engine.ini` or `Game.ini` to increase the tickrate and bandwidth. This can help with connection problems but requires more CPU power and bandwidth.

You can select 'Create Game' in the Server Manager in the game to create a new world with a specific starting area and session name.

Yes, you can activate the Advanced Game Settings when creating a new world or subsequently (via save editors or console commands) to e.g. allow flight mode or deactivate build costs.
